El diseño web es una disciplina que se encuentra en constante evolución, siempre en busca de nuevas tendencias y tecnologías que permitan crear experiencias más atractivas y funcionales en los sitios web. En este artículo, exploraremos algunas herramientas esenciales, principios de diseño, tendencias actuales y consejos de optimización y rendimiento que te ayudarán a llevar tus proyectos al siguiente nivel.
Herramientas esenciales para el diseño web
Para poder crear diseños web de calidad, es importante contar con las herramientas adecuadas. Algunas de las herramientas esenciales para el diseño web incluyen:
- Editor de código: Un editor de código como Visual Studio Code o Sublime Text te permitirá escribir y editar el código HTML, CSS y JavaScript de tus proyectos.
- Software de diseño gráfico: Programas como Adobe Photoshop o Sketch son ideales para crear y editar imágenes y gráficos que serán utilizados en el diseño web.
- Framework CSS: Utilizar un framework CSS como Bootstrap o Foundation puede acelerar el proceso de desarrollo y ayudarte a crear diseños responsivos de manera más eficiente.
Principios de diseño web que debes conocer
Al diseñar un sitio web, es importante tener en cuenta algunos principios básicos que te ayudarán a crear una experiencia de usuario agradable y efectiva. Algunos de estos principios incluyen:
- Usabilidad: El diseño web debe ser intuitivo y fácil de usar, permitiendo a los usuarios encontrar la información que buscan de manera rápida y sencilla.
- Jerarquía visual: Utilizar elementos visuales como el tamaño, el color y la posición para guiar a los usuarios a través de la página y resaltar la información más importante.
- Consistencia: Mantener una apariencia y estructura consistentes en todas las páginas del sitio, creando así una experiencia coherente para los usuarios.
Tendencias actuales en diseño web
El diseño web está en constante evolución, y es importante mantenerse al día con las últimas tendencias para crear sitios modernos y atractivos. Algunas de las tendencias actuales en diseño web incluyen:
- Diseño minimalista: Utilizar elementos simples y limpios para crear un diseño minimalista y elegante.
- Diseño responsive: Diseñar sitios web que se adapten a diferentes dispositivos y tamaños de pantalla, ofreciendo así una experiencia óptima para todos los usuarios.
- Animaciones y microinteracciones: Utilizar animaciones sutiles y microinteracciones para agregar interactividad y dinamismo a los sitios web.
Optimización y rendimiento en diseño web
La optimización y el rendimiento son aspectos fundamentales en el diseño web, ya que afectan directamente la experiencia del usuario. Algunos consejos para mejorar el rendimiento de tu sitio web incluyen:
- Optimizar imágenes: Comprimir y optimizar las imágenes para reducir su tamaño y mejorar los tiempos de carga.
- Minificar archivos CSS y JavaScript: Eliminar espacios y comentarios innecesarios en los archivos CSS y JavaScript para reducir su tamaño y mejorar la velocidad de carga.
- Utilizar caché: Configurar el almacenamiento en caché para que los elementos estáticos del sitio se guarden en el navegador del usuario y se carguen más rápidamente en visitas posteriores.
Conclusión
El diseño web es una disciplina apasionante que requiere conocimientos y habilidades técnicas, así como un enfoque centrado en el usuario y la creatividad. Con las herramientas adecuadas, la aplicación de principios de diseño sólidos, la atención a las tendencias actuales y la optimización del rendimiento, podrás llevar tus proyectos de diseño web al siguiente nivel.
Preguntas frecuentes
¿Cuáles son los mejores programas para diseñar páginas web?
Algunos de los mejores programas para diseñar páginas web son Adobe Photoshop, Sketch y Figma.
¿Qué es el diseño responsive y por qué es importante?
El diseño responsive es una técnica de diseño web que permite que los sitios se adapten y se vean bien en diferentes dispositivos y tamaños de pantalla. Es importante porque garantiza una experiencia óptima para todos los usuarios, independientemente del dispositivo que utilicen.
¿Cómo puedo mejorar la velocidad de carga de mi sitio web?
Algunas formas de mejorar la velocidad de carga de tu sitio web incluyen optimizar las imágenes, minificar los archivos CSS y JavaScript, utilizar una red de distribución de contenido (CDN) y configurar el almacenamiento en caché.
¿Cuáles son las mejores prácticas para la accesibilidad web?
Algunas de las mejores prácticas para la accesibilidad web incluyen utilizar texto alternativo en las imágenes, proporcionar subtítulos en los videos, utilizar colores contrastantes y asegurarse de que el sitio sea navegable mediante el teclado.